The supervisor will outline possible approaches and offer guidance and advice during the course of the project.&lt;/span&gt;&lt;/span&gt;&lt;/p&gt;&lt;p style="border-style:none;padding:0cm;"&gt;&amp;nbsp;&lt;/p&gt;&lt;/div&gt;&lt;p&gt;&lt;span style="color:black;font-family:&amp;quot;Microsoft Sans Serif&amp;quot;,sans-serif;font-size:11.0pt;"&gt;&lt;span style="layout-grid-mode:line;"&gt;The student will carry out an individual study of a current topic in physics, which should show evidence of original thinking. The project can take many different forms – for example, it may have a design element or a simulation/analysis element. In some cases, it may be largely a review of the literature for a specific topic, but with some scope for critical evaluation and/or own work. Whatever the focus is, the dissertation should contain a comprehensive literature review. The focus of the project should be clearly on the physics, broadly construed; students unsure whether their planned approach meets this criterion should discuss the issue with their supervisor.&amp;nbsp;The student will write a report along the lines of a scientific article.&amp;nbsp; The length of the report should be between 4000 and 6000 words.&amp;nbsp; At the end of the project the student will give a 5 minute presentation followed by a 25 minute question and answer session.&lt;/span&gt;&lt;/span&gt;&lt;/p&gt;</Content>

    <Content>&lt;div style="border:1.0pt solid windowtext;padding:1.0pt 6.0pt 1.0pt 4.0pt;"&gt;&lt;p style="border-style:none;padding:0cm;"&gt;&lt;span style="color:black;font-family:&amp;quot;Microsoft Sans Serif&amp;quot;,sans-serif;font-size:11.0pt;"&gt;The students will have a weekly meeting with their supervisor. They will also have the opportunity to submit a full draft dissertation to their supervisor in advance of the final submission, on which they will be given feedback. After the interview, additional feedback will be given by the assessors.&lt;/span&gt;&lt;/p&gt;&lt;/div&gt;</Content>
